What are the causes of anemia in men?

Causes of anemia in men:

1. Irregular life: high study pressure, mental fatigue, excessive physical exertion, lack of sleep, which affects health and promotes anemia. This is one of the causes of anemia. Iron deficiency anemia: increased iron requirement but insufficient intake, poor iron absorption, and blood loss.

2. The causes of anemia also include decreased red blood cell production and decreased bone marrow hematopoietic function, which can cause aplastic anemia or pure erythrocytic aplastic anemia; the bone marrow is invaded by abnormal tissue, causing myeloid anemia; lack of hematopoietic raw materials, such as iron deficiency anemia and nutritional macrocytic anemia.

3. Long-term intense exercise: The iron concentration in sweat can reach 40-60 micrograms/ml. When exercising excessively, the human body sweats more, and the loss of iron increases. After exercise, the body's need for iron increases accordingly. In addition, intense exercise can also damage red blood cells or cause muscle damage, resulting in excessive iron loss. Therefore, long-term intense exercise can easily lead to iron deficiency in the body. These causes of anemia are relatively common.

The above is an introduction to the causes of anemia in men. Generally speaking, there are many causes of anemia in men. Bad living habits, long-term strenuous exercise, and some diseases can all lead to anemia in men.
